An engineer in a locomotive sees a car stuck
on the track at a railroad crossing in front of
the train. when the engineer first sees the
car, the locomotive is 270 m from the crossing
and its speed is 12 m/s.
if the engineer’s reaction time is 0.79 s,
what should be the magnitude of the minimum deceleration to avoid an accident?
answer in units of m/s
2
.
